E.g., if build and run +x86/nested_emulation_test on Ubuntu 24.04 will encounter a L1 #PF due to +memset() reference to __memset_chk@plt. + +The option -fno-builtin-memset is not helpful here, because those +fortified versions are not built-in but some definitions which are +included by header, they are for different intentions. + +In order to eliminate the unpredictable behaviors may vary depending on +the linker and platform, add the "-U_FORTIFY_SOURCE" into CFLAGS to +prevent from introducing the fortified definitions. + +Signed-off-by: Zhiquan Li +Link: https://patch.msgid.link/20260122053551.548229-1-zhiquan_li@163.com +Fixes: 6b6f71484bf4 ("KVM: selftests: Implement memcmp(), memcpy(), and memset() for guest use") +Cc: stable@vger.kernel.org +[sean: tag for stable] +Signed-off-by: Sean Christopherson +[ Makefile.kvm -> Makefile ] +Signed-off-by: Sasha Levin +Signed-off-by: Greg Kroah-Hartman +--- + tools/testing/selftests/kvm/Makefile | 1 + + 1 file changed, 1 insertion(+) + +--- a/tools/testing/selftests/kvm/Makefile ++++ b/tools/testing/selftests/kvm/Makefile +@@ -212,6 +212,7 @@ LINUX_TOOL_ARCH_INCLUDE = $(top_srcdir)/ + endif + CFLAGS += -Wall -Wstrict-prototypes -Wuninitialized -O2 -g -std=gnu99 \ + -Wno-gnu-variable-sized-type-not-at-end -MD\ ++ -U_FORTIFY_SOURCE \ + -fno-builtin-memcmp -fno-builtin-memcpy -fno-builtin-memset \ + -fno-builtin-strnlen \ + -fno-stack-protector -fno-PIE -I$(LINUX_TOOL_INCLUDE) \ diff --git a/queue-6.6/series b/queue-6.6/series index 2541229f31..d62c5e16fd 100644 --- a/queue-6.6/series +++ b/queue-6.6/series @@ -16,3 +16,6 @@ ublk-fix-deadlock-when-reading-partition-table.patch sched-rt-fix-race-in-push_rt_task.patch binder-fix-br_frozen_reply-error-log.patch binderfs-fix-ida_alloc_max-upper-bound.patch +kvm-selftests-add-u_fortify_source-to-avoid-some-unpredictable-test-failures.patch +gve-fix-stats-report-corruption-on-queue-count-change.patch +tracing-fix-ftrace-event-field-alignments.patch diff --git a/queue-6.6/tracing-fix-ftrace-event-field-alignments.patch b/queue-6.6/tracing-fix-ftrace-event-field-alignments.patch new file mode 100644 index 0000000000..43b622430e --- /dev/null +++ b/queue-6.6/tracing-fix-ftrace-event-field-alignments.patch @@ -0,0 +1,207 @@ +From stable+bounces-214808-greg=kroah.com@vger.kernel.org Sat Feb 7 17:52:59 2026 +From: Sasha Levin +Date: Sat, 7 Feb 2026 11:52:19 -0500 +Subject: tracing: Fix ftrace event field alignments +To: stable@vger.kernel.org +Cc: Steven Rostedt , Mathieu Desnoyers , Mark Rutland , "Masami Hiramatsu (Google)" , "jempty.liang" , Sasha Levin +Message-ID: <20260207165219.435349-1-sashal@kernel.org> + +From: Steven Rostedt + +[ Upstream commit 033c55fe2e326bea022c3cc5178ecf3e0e459b82 ] + +The fields of ftrace specific events (events used to save ftrace internal +events like function traces and trace_printk) are generated similarly to +how normal trace event fields are generated. That is, the fields are added +to a trace_events_fields array that saves the name, offset, size, +alignment and signness of the field. It is used to produce the output in +the format file in tracefs so that tooling knows how to parse the binary +data of the trace events. + +The issue is that some of the ftrace event structures are packed. The +function graph exit event structures are one of them. The 64 bit calltime +and rettime fields end up 4 byte aligned, but the algorithm to show to +userspace shows them as 8 byte aligned. + +The macros that create the ftrace events has one for embedded structure +fields. There's two macros for theses fields: + + __field_desc() and __field_packed() + +The difference of the latter macro is that it treats the field as packed. + +Rename that field to __field_desc_packed() and create replace the +__field_packed() to be a normal field that is packed and have the calltime +and rettime use those. + +This showed up on 32bit architectures for function graph time fields. It +had: + + ~# cat /sys/kernel/tracing/events/ftrace/funcgraph_exit/format +[..] + field:unsigned long func; offset:8; size:4; signed:0; + field:unsigned int depth; offset:12; size:4; signed:0; + field:unsigned int overrun; offset:16; size:4; signed:0; + field:unsigned long long calltime; offset:24; size:8; signed:0; + field:unsigned long long rettime; offset:32; size:8; signed:0; + +Notice that overrun is at offset 16 with size 4, where in the structure +calltime is at offset 20 (16 + 4), but it shows the offset at 24. That's +because it used the alignment of unsigned long long when used as a +declaration and not as a member of a structure where it would be aligned +by word size (in this case 4). + +By using the proper structure alignment, the format has it at the correct +offset: + + ~# cat /sys/kernel/tracing/events/ftrace/funcgraph_exit/format +[..] + field:unsigned long func;
